Why are scientists trying to create small black holes in particle colliders?
The detection of the mini black holes would indicate the existence of extra dimensions, which would support string theory and related models that predict the existence of extra dimensions as well as parallel universes.

What is the smallest black hole possible?
NASA scientists have identified the lightest black hole yet, just 3.8 times the mass of the sun, in a binary star system in the Milky Way known as XTE J1650-500. The next smallest black hole, spotted in 1994, weighed in at 6.3 solar masses.
How are micro black holes formed?
High-energy collisions of particles may have created tiny black holes in the early Universe, which might leave stable remnants instead of fully evaporating as a result of Hawking radiation.

What is a microscopic black hole?
Micro black hole. Micro black holes, also called quantum mechanical black holes or mini black holes, are hypothetical tiny black holes, for which quantum mechanical effects play an important role.
